After displaying signs of improved life at the beginning of the month, Marlton real estate unfortunately settled back into same doldrums they've been displaying for the previous few months. Across the board statistics showed decreased activity that mimicked trends across Burlington County. Sold transactions were down about 9% from 2010, but new listings for the month of March were down over 30% and the number of pending properties were down over 40%. It also appears that the stubbornness of sellers that I mentioned a month ago is still continuing. In the face of the rough sales numbers the average listing price in March was $35,000 higher than last year. Average sold prices and days on market both showed minor drop offs. As the selling season settles in I'm hopeful that improved employment numbers translate into market improvement.
